An explosive situation: By using gold nanoparticles and taking advantage of the donor–acceptor interaction between trinitrotoluene (TNT) and cysteamine, the visualization of TNT can be achieved at picomolar levels (see picture). The color change from red to blue can be seen with the naked eye, which allows sensitive on-the-spot detection.
